Summary

On 17 December 2013 at about 21:00 local time, a Quicksilver UNKNOWN registered UNREG was involved in an accident near Palestine, Texas, United States. One person was on board and one was seriously injured. The aircraft was substantially damaged. The NTSB has published a probable cause for this accident; it is quoted in full below.

Probable cause

The noncertificated pilot’s failure to maintain airspeed, which resulted in an inadvertent stall during landing.

Quoted verbatim from the NTSB record. This site does not paraphrase or interpret it.

Read the full NTSB narrative

The noncertificated pilot was on a local flight in his unregistered airplane. The pilot reported that he did not recall any details of the accident. Witness reports indicated that the pilot was attempting to land the airplane on a runway, it stalled, and it then nosed down onto the runway. Calm wind prevailed at the airport about the time of the accident.
